Why do I need to be baptized if I have already accepted Jesus as my Savior?

Jesus has commanded that all who accept Him and want to come to Him must be baptized.  Jesus told Nicodemus, “Verily, verily, I say unto thee, Except a man be born of water and of the Spirit, he cannot enter into the kingdom of God (John 3:5).  To be born of water means to be baptized and to be born of the Spirit means to receive that Holy Spirit as your constant companion.  The Book of Mormon teaches this very clearly:

“And now, if the Lamb of God, he being holy, should have need to be baptized by water, to fulfil all righteousness, O then, how much more need have we, being unholy, to be baptized, yea, even by water!  And now, I would ask of you, my beloved brethren, wherein the Lamb of God did fulfil all righteousness in being baptized by water?  Know ye not that he was holy? But notwithstanding he being holy, he showeth unto the children of men that, according to the flesh he humbleth himself before the Father, and witnesseth unto the Father that he would be obedient unto him in keeping his commandments (2 Nephi 31:5-7).”

Even Jesus had to be baptized in order to continue being perfectly righteous.    In the Book of Mormon Jesus says to the ancient inhabitants of the Americas:

” And no unclean thing can enter into his kingdom; therefore nothing entereth into his rest save it be those who have washed their garments in my blood, because of their faith, and the repentance of all their sins, and their faithfulness unto the end.   Now this is the commandment: Repent, all ye ends of the earth, and come unto me and be baptized in my name, that ye may be sanctified by the reception of the Holy Ghost, that ye may stand spotless before me at the last day (3 Nephi 27:19-20).”

Since everyone has sinned, we are all unclean before God and need to be cleansed of our sins.  To do this, we must come unto Jesus Christ through baptism and then we will receive the Holy Ghost.
